Kanye West is preparing to release his 12th studio album, BULLY, on March 27. The album has seen multiple delays concerning its release. Traders on prediction markets are weighing exact unit ranges for the debut week. Ye BULLY album sales betting odds center on conservative estimates amid recent industry shifts.
The project arrives through an independent partnership with Gamma. Recording stretches back more than three years. Themes center on remorse, memory, ego, faith, and consequence according to official statements. With Kanye, you know the topics will be heavy and serious.

Kanye West’s BULLY Album First Week Sales Predictions Draw on Historical Data
Past solo releases provide context for current expectations. Early-career albums posted massive opening-week sales. Recent projects show more modest totals in a changed industry landscape.
Debut-week performance varies with rollout strategy. Traditional album cycles once drove higher pure sales. Streaming now contributes heavily to equivalent units.
Historical First Week Performance of Kanye West Albums
| Album | Year | First-Week Units |
|---|---|---|
| The College Dropout | 2004 | 441,000 |
| Late Registration | 2005 | 860,000 |
| Graduation | 2007 | 957,000 |
| Donda | 2021 | 309,000 |
| Vultures 1 | 2024 | 148,000 |
Peak sales occurred during the mid-2000s. Later albums reflect evolving consumption habits. BULLY album first-week sales predictions place the new release between recent lows and classic highs.
Pre-saves reportedly exceed 613,000 across platforms. This metric fuels optimism among some traders. Equivalent units include streaming and track sales in final tallies.
Industry Projections Align Closely with Ye BULLY Album Sales Betting Odds
Hits Daily Double forecasts 250,000 to 275,000 album-equivalent units. Such totals would secure the top spot on the Billboard 200. Analysts note the figure aligns with the dominant market outcome.
